Mention191332

Download triples
rdf:type qkg:Mention
so:text Object-oriented programming languages support encapsulation, thereby improving the ability of software to be reused, refined, tested, maintained, and extended. The full benefit of this support can only be realized if encapsulation is maximized during the design process. We argue that design practices which take a data-driven approach fail to maximize encapsulation because they focus too quickly on the implementation of objects. We propose an alternative object-oriented design method which takes a responsibility-driven approach. We show how such an approach can increase the encapsulation by deferring implementation issues until a later stage. (en)
so:isPartOf https://en.wikiquote.org/wiki/Rebecca_Wirfs-Brock
so:description Object-oriented design: a responsibility-driven approach (1989) (en)
qkg:hasContext qkg:Context94031
Property Object

Triples where Mention191332 is the object (without rdf:type)

qkg:Quotation179886 qkg:hasMention
Subject Property